Output eda68a76373be5da7c934e34c6a3098a99ef989ec3ff19c1c5ab8a95b190487f:0

value
6969593278211
script pubkey
OP_0 OP_PUSHBYTES_20 5c7b19608209dcc8f5a2f31131901ef37ebb1dfe
address
tb1qt3a3jcyzp8wv3adz7vgnryq77dltk807thfrfk
transaction
eda68a76373be5da7c934e34c6a3098a99ef989ec3ff19c1c5ab8a95b190487f
confirmations
172984
spent
true